Eero's Memorial FundChanges to the Eero's Memorial Fund in 2012.  For 2012, applicants do not need to be members of our credit union.  As before, the Eero's Memorial Fund will award 4 students who are in their 2nd year or higher of university with a bursary of $5,000 each.   To read more about who Eero Blomberg was, read our OP News section.  Eero stipulated the following specific criteria in order to qualify for his bursary:
 

  • Candidates must be a Canadian citizen, having a parent or grand parent who was born in Finland.
  • Candidates must submit transcripts of their final year in high school proving an overall average of 75% or higher 
  • Candidates must submit a one-page, single spaced, font size 12, essay on what "being of Finnish heritage" means to them.
  • Candidates must provide details of which parent/grand parent was of Finnish heritage



Hanne Maijala Memorial Scholarship

For post-secondary studies in the arts.  Qualifying students must be Osuuspankki members.


Marja Karlsson Memorial ScholarshipThis scholarship is dedicated in memory of a long-time General Manager of Osuuspankki, Marja Karlsson. It is granted to students entering their second or subsequent year of post-secondary studies at college or university and is given over two years.  Qualifying students must be Osuuspankki Members.

Osuuspankki ScholarshipGranted to students who are members of Osuuspankki and who demonstrate a combination of academic achievement, financial need and community involvement.
